Section 458.331(1)(k), Florida Statutes (2002), provides that the act of making deceptive, untrue, or fraudulent representations in or related to the practice of medicine or employing a trick or scheme in the practice of medicine constitutes grounds for disciplinary action against a licensed professional by the Board of Medicine. 18. By failing to identify himself as a physician’s assistant, failing to advise patients of their right to see a supervising physician, and being designated as “Doctor” within his clinical practices, Respondent has willfully and fraudulently held himself out to be a licensed physician. 19. By continuing to treat, prescribe medication for, and refer patients to himself by using Dr. R.F.R.’s Medipass number after receiving notification of the termination of his association with AMC, Respondent willfully employed fraudulent means to obtain and treat patients. Section 458.331(1)(I), Florida Statutes (2002), provides that the act of soliciting patients, either personally or through an agent, through the use of fraud or a form of overreaching conduct will constitute grounds for disciplinary action against a licensed professional by the Board of Medicine. 23. Respondent willfully employed fraudulent means to acquire and treat patients by continuing to treat patients under Dr. R.F.R.’s Medipass number, prescribe medication for these patients, and refer patients to himself by using Dr. R.F.R.’s Medipass number afer receiving notification of the termination of R.F.R.’s association with AMC. Section 458.331(1)(v), Florida Statutes (2002), provides that the act of practicing or offering to practice beyond the scope permitted by law or accepting and performing professional responsibilities which the licensee knows or has reason to know that he or she is not competent to perform will constitute grounds for disciplinary action by the Board of Medicine. 27. Respondent's actions of referring and treating patients allegedly under the supervision of a physician who had previously terminated his professional association with Respondent and Respondent's place of work was a ploy to willfully practice as a licensed physician when Respondent was only licensed as a physician’s assistant in the State of Florida. 28. F FEB-23-2885 1@:21 AHCA Sunient P NOTICE OF RIGHTS Respondent has the right to request a hearing to be conducted in accordance with Section 120.569 and 120.57, Florida Statutes, to be represented by counsel or other qualified representative, to present evidence and argument, to call and cross-examine witnesses and to have subpoena and subpoena duces tecum issued on his or her behalf if a hearing is requested. NOTICE REGARDING ASSESSMENT OF COSTS Respondent is placed on notice that Petitioner has incurred costs related to the investigation and prosecution of this matter. Pursuant to Section 456.072(4), Florida Statutes, the Board shall assess costs related to the investigation and prosecution of a disciplinary matter, which may include attorney hours and costs, on the Respondent in addition to any other discipline imposed. 9 Carlos M_Millan, P.A., Case # 2003-18338 1! ~14
